Utilizing MRI and CT to identify risk factors associated with cage subsidence
Abstract Objectives To identify risk factors associated with cage subsidence (CS) following single segment transforaminal lumbar interbody fusion (TLIF) and unilateral biportal endoscopic lumbar interbody fusion (ULIF) and to compare the predictive performance of various bone quality assessment meth...
